NCT ID: NCT04097899 Completed - Clinical trials for Ventilator Associated Pneumonia

Antimicrobial Stewardship Program and Ventilator Associated Pneumonia

Start date: July 1, 2016
Phase:
Study type: Observational

Antibiotic Stewardship Programs (ASPs) help clinicians improve the quality of patient care and improve patient safety through increased infection cure rates, reduced treatment failures; however, there are different techniques, with variable results, of its application including what is called ASPs bundle and there is a need to investigate the effectiveness of implementing a comprehensive care bundle program including the key components of ASPs and the key items of infection control measures, this program can be called Antimicrobial Stewardship Comprehensive Care Bundle Program (ASCCBP).

NCT ID: NCT04087460 Completed - Pneumonia Clinical Trials

Phase Ⅰa Clinical Trial of a Pneumococcal Vaccine

P?CTPV
Start date: April 10, 2020
Phase: Early Phase 1
Study type: Interventional

Infections with Streptococcus pneumoniae often cause serious health problems, especially for infants and the elderly.Failure to cover all polysaccharide types is an even greater problem with adults than with children. The aim of the study is to preliminary evaluate the safety and immunogenicity of PBPV vaccine compared to placebo,in order to provide a basis for subsequent clinical trial design.

NCT ID: NCT04048018 Completed - Clinical trials for Latent Tuberculosis Infection

Performance Evaluation of the VIDAS TB-IGRA Assay.

Start date: December 5, 2019
Phase:
Study type: Observational

This study will evaluate the performance of the VIDAS® Interferon Gamma (IFN-γ) Release Assay (TB-IGRA) assay, which is intended for use as an aid in the diagnosis of tuberculosis infection. This study is designed to assess (1) the sensitivity of this assay, (2) its percent agreement with other diagnostic tests, (3) its measurement precision , and (4) any potential interference of the presence of other non-tuberculosis mycobacterial bacterial infections with this assay.

NCT ID: NCT04047719 Completed - Pneumonia, Viral Clinical Trials

Pneumonia in the ImmunoCompromised - Use of the Karius Test for the Detection of Undiagnosed Pathogens

PICKUP
Start date: November 5, 2019
Phase:
Study type: Observational

Given the need for a more sensitive pathogen detection test in patients with immunocompromised pneumonia, this study will evaluate the performance of the Karius Test, a novel NGS blood test for the diagnosis of infectious diseases. We will compare the performance of the Karius Test to the results of microbiologic tests obtained as part of usual care for immunocompromised patients undergoing evaluation for suspected pneumonia.

NCT ID: NCT04041791 Completed - Pneumonia Clinical Trials

A Study to Compare Different Antibiotics and Different Modes of Fluid Treatment for Children With Severe Pneumonia

SEARCH
Start date: August 19, 2019
Phase: Phase 3
Study type: Interventional

Pneumonia is one of the top causes of death in children aged below 5. More than 10% of children with severe pneumonia die. We are not sure that the currently recommended antibiotics used in children with pneumonia are the most effective. No studies have been carried out to find out whether children with pneumonia should be given intravenous (IV) fluids or nasogastric (NG) feeds. The SEARCH trial aims to find out which antibiotics and modes of feeding are the most effective in treating children with severe pneumonia and therefore helping reduce mortality.

NCT ID: NCT04038814 Completed - Clinical trials for VAP - Ventilator Associated Pneumonia

The Effectiveness of the Modified Bundle in the Prevention of VAP.

VAP
Start date: June 1, 2018
Phase:
Study type: Observational

Ventilator-associated pneumonia (VAP) is an important cause of prolonged intensive care unit and hospital length of stay, healthcare costs and mortality in mechanically ventilated patients. There are an international guidelines for VAP diagnosis, treatment and prevention (Infectious Diseases Society of America(IDSA)/American Thoracic Society (ATS) 2016 and European Respiratory Society (ERS) / European Society of Intensive Care Medicine (ESICM) / European Society of Clinical Microbiology and Infectiuos Diseases (ESCMID) / Asociacion Latinoamericana del Torax (ALAT) 2017) routinely used in most ICUs. The investigator planed on comparing two strategies for prevention of VAP in mechanically ventilated patients: the routine VAP bundle ( historical group - VAP1) and the modified VAP bundle ( study group - VAP2) by using 3 modifications ( Shiley Evac Endotracheal tube with TaperGuard Cuff, Automatic continuous subglottic secretion drainage (SSD) and continuous tube cuff pressure monitoring). The aim of the study is an assessment of the effectiveness of the modified prevention of VAP in reduction of: early and late VAP cases, mechanical ventilation days (MV), length of stay (LOS) in the ICU, 28 day mortality and multi drug resistent pathogens (MDR) cases in adult ICU patients.
